A significant fire erupted at a hospital in Germany, resulting in the loss of two lives and the evacuation of multiple patients from the premises. The incident, which occurred at the LUP Clinic’s five-story structure at approximately 4:30 am local time, left over 30 individuals injured, as reported by the authorities.
The fire is believed to have originated in the roof of the radiology building, leading to the evacuation of not only that building but also adjacent structures. Both deceased individuals were patients at the hospital, according to Germany’s dpa news agency.
Following the fire, patients were found outside the hospital in their night attire earlier today, as detailed by local outlet Nordkurier. Some patients were also evacuated in their hospital beds and transported to safety by emergency responders.
